Review of the medium-batch landed this session surfaced three issues:
P0 — symlink-ancestor escape in extractMediaFromContent. The lexical
filepath.Rel check passed "<ws>/shared/secret" when "shared" was a
symlink pointing outside the workspace. EvalSymlinks the resolved path
(and the workspace root, since macOS uses /var → /private/var) before
the Rel containment check. Leaf symlinks still rejected by Lstat.
P1 — duplicate attachments from path aliases. parseMediaResult stores
raw tool output ("./tts/x.mp3"); extractMediaFromContent stores Abs+
Clean ("<ws>/tts/x.mp3"). deduplicateMedia's exact-string map let both
through. Normalize the dedup key via filepath.Abs + Clean so the
sources collapse.
P1 — TTS Result.Media used the non-standard "audio/mp3" via
"audio/"+Extension. SynthResult.MimeType is already populated by every
provider with the RFC-3003 "audio/mpeg" (or "audio/ogg" for opus).
Prefer it; keep the extension concat as empty-string fallback.
Tests: add symlink-leaf-rejected and ancestor-symlink-escape cases to
lock the P0 behavior.
